The first song I fell in love with
One autumn afternoon, I felt unwell and stayed in as a six-year-old. My mom asked, "Is it true you don't know the Beatles?" She started Help! the film, after which I listened to it on loop through her music player for hours.
My karaoke go-to
Anything David Bowie is really fun, such as Fame or Queen Bitch. It's impossible to imitate Bowie, but I love the energy. I recently tried Save Me by the artist Aimee Mann, that made people lose interest, yet I enjoyed myself.
The debut physical music I owned
Friends were into Paradise by the band Coldplay, so I acquired Mylo Xyloto at the bookstore. It occurred during my debut California journey. I thought to purchase records. I acquired those two albums on the same day.
The song I inexplicably know every lyric to
My older brother owned Incredibad by Lonely Island as a compact disc. He played it constantly in the car. Experiencing something material considered off-limits proved thrilling.
The ideal party track
This classic from The Emotions since it feels joyful. Its tempo is flawless. It's accessible music, cool and challenging, so it suits everyone.
The track I avoid now
As I explored rock music, I adored Guns N' Roses. Initially experiencing Sweet Child O' Mine, I became obsessed, though presently I skip it.
The ideal track to perform
Right now, my band and I are covering Another Girl, Another Planet. I adore that track.
The transformative music
I appear in the music video for Guilt Trip by Pup. I acted as the youthful counterpart of the vocalist. This marked my video debut. It introduced intense audio, pushing me into the alt scene.
